Anna Volokitin is a scholar working on Computer Vision and Pattern Recognition, Surgery and Cognitive Neuroscience. According to data from OpenAlex, Anna Volokitin has authored 10 papers receiving a total of 250 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 8 papers in Computer Vision and Pattern Recognition, 2 papers in Surgery and 2 papers in Cognitive Neuroscience. Recurrent topics in Anna Volokitin’s work include Video Analysis and Summarization (2 papers), Visual perception and processing mechanisms (2 papers) and Generative Adversarial Networks and Image Synthesis (2 papers). Anna Volokitin is often cited by papers focused on Video Analysis and Summarization (2 papers), Visual perception and processing mechanisms (2 papers) and Generative Adversarial Networks and Image Synthesis (2 papers). Anna Volokitin collaborates with scholars based in Switzerland, United States and Belgium. Anna Volokitin's co-authors include Radu Timofte, Eirikur Agustsson, Raphael Patcas, Rasmus Rothe, Luc Van Gool, Michael Gygli, Gemma Roig, Theodore Eliades, Tomaso Poggio and Martina Eichenberger and has published in prestigious journals such as Journal of Vision, European Journal of Orthodontics and International Journal of Oral and Maxillofacial Surgery.
